What is an LMS?
A Learning Management System is a essential tool that enables educators to develop online courses with ease.
What Makes an LMS Effective?
- Course Creation: Tools to build, structure, and organize digital courses.
- User Management: Simplified student enrollment.
- Assessments & Quizzes: Interactive tools for measuring learning outcomes.
- Progress Tracking: Comprehensive reporting tools.
- Mobile Compatibility: Responsive design for all devices.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Can I use an LMS for free?
Yes, open-source LMS solutions like Moodle are available.
What industries use LMS?
Any field requiring structured learning benefits from LMS software.
Is an LMS beginner-friendly?
Many modern LMS options are designed for ease of use.
